Section 1 Overview

The Rambouillet stands as the foundation of the American fine-wool industry, developed from Spanish Merino stock imported to France in the late 1700s and later brought to the United States where the breed thrived on western rangelands in ways that many other sheep could not match. These large-framed sheep produce some of the finest wool commercially available while also providing a respectable carcass for meat production, making them genuinely dual-purpose animals in operations that value both products. Their hardiness, herding instinct, and ability to cover rough terrain while maintaining condition made them the dominant breed across vast stretches of the American West during the height of the open range sheep industry.

Rambouillets combine the fine wool characteristics of their Merino ancestors with a larger body frame developed through selective breeding in both France and America. The French name comes from the royal farm at Rambouillet where King Louis XVI established a flock from sheep purchased from the Spanish crown in 1786, beginning the selective improvement that would eventually produce a distinct breed. American breeders continued this development, selecting for animals that could survive the harsh conditions of western ranges while producing heavy fleeces of consistently fine fiber. The result is a sheep that performs well in environments too demanding for less robust breeds.

The wool that Rambouillets produce remains their primary value for many producers, with fiber fineness typically falling between nineteen and twenty-four microns - fine enough for soft, next-to-skin garments while yielding heavier fleece weights than many other fine-wool breeds. This combination of quality and quantity makes Rambouillet wool desirable to both commercial buyers and handspinners seeking premium fiber. The breed's tight-crimped, dense fleece also provides protection against weather extremes, helping sheep maintain condition through hot summers and cold winters that would stress breeds with less functional fleece characteristics.

Section 2 Essential Requirements

Housing requirements for Rambouillets reflect their development as range sheep capable of surviving with minimal shelter across open western landscapes. These sheep do not require elaborate barns or confinement housing under most circumstances - a three-sided shelter providing wind protection and dry ground during extreme weather satisfies their needs during most of the year. The dense, weatherproof fleece that made Rambouillets successful on open ranges continues to serve them well, providing natural insulation against both cold and heat when they have access to shade during summer months. However, housing becomes more important around lambing time and during shearing when sheep lack their protective fleece.

Fencing must contain sheep that retain strong flocking instincts and the ability to cover ground when motivated to move. Rambouillets generally respect standard sheep fencing better than some breeds, staying together as a group rather than testing boundaries individually. Woven wire fencing standing at least forty-two inches tall with tight bottom spacing to prevent lamb escapes handles most situations. Larger operations on rangeland traditionally used herders and dogs to manage sheep movement rather than relying entirely on fencing, though modern operations increasingly use permanent and temporary fencing to control grazing patterns without constant human presence.

Pasture and forage requirements depend heavily on your geographic location and the stocking density you plan to maintain. Rambouillets evolved to thrive on sparse western rangelands where they walk considerable distances daily to find adequate forage, developing efficient grazing habits that extract nutrition from vegetation other breeds might ignore. On improved pastures with better forage availability, Rambouillets perform very well but may become overly conditioned if forage quality significantly exceeds their evolved requirements. Match your stocking rate to available forage, provide adequate water sources across grazing areas, and implement rotational grazing if possible to maintain pasture health and parasite pressure management.

Water access matters more than some producers realize, particularly for sheep producing heavy wool loads that increase insulation and heat stress risk. Rambouillets need clean, accessible water throughout the year, with multiple water points across larger pastures to ensure sheep can drink without traveling excessive distances. Water consumption increases dramatically during hot weather, lactation, and late pregnancy, so base your water system capacity on peak demand rather than average needs. During winter in cold climates, preventing water sources from freezing or providing heated waterers ensures continuous access when sheep cannot obtain moisture from lush green forage.

Handling facilities appropriate for working Rambouillets should accommodate their larger frame size compared to many other sheep breeds. Mature Rambouillet ewes commonly weigh between one hundred fifty and two hundred pounds, with rams reaching two hundred fifty to three hundred pounds or more. Chutes, sorting alleys, and headgates must be sized and constructed to handle these weights without breaking or allowing animals to escape during necessary procedures. The breed's generally calm temperament makes handling easier than some more excitable breeds, but facilities should still allow moving sheep without the handler being in exposed positions with large animals.

Section 3 Daily Care And Management

Daily observation of your Rambouillet flock identifies problems early when intervention remains simple and effective. Walk through your sheep at least once daily during routine work, watching for animals separating from the group, showing lameness, or displaying abnormal behavior that suggests illness or injury. The dense fleece that protects Rambouillets from weather also hides weight loss and developing problems from casual observation, making hands-on evaluation during handling sessions essential for monitoring true body condition. Learn what healthy sheep look like in terms of posture, movement, and interaction with flockmates so you can spot deviations quickly.

Feeding routines for Rambouillets should match their evolutionary history as efficient grazers capable of maintaining condition on modest forage. Good quality pasture meets nutritional needs during much of the year, supplemented with hay when growing conditions limit grazing availability. Grain supplementation becomes important during late gestation when ewes carrying multiple lambs need energy density their compressed rumen cannot obtain from forage alone. Mineral supplementation using sheep-specific formulations provides the trace elements that forage may lack, with particular attention to selenium in deficient regions. Avoid over-conditioning these naturally thrifty sheep - a Rambouillet that looks plump may actually be carrying excessive fat that creates problems during breeding and lambing.

Wool management throughout the year protects your fleece investment and maintains sheep comfort and health. Keep Rambouillets away from vegetation that contaminates fleeces with vegetable matter - burdock, cocklebur, and similar plants ruin the value of otherwise premium wool. Provide clean bedding if sheep are housed, as straw chaff and other debris embedded in fleece reduces its value. Watch for fleece problems including wool break from nutritional stress, skin conditions that damage fiber, and external parasites that affect wool quality and sheep comfort.

Section 4 Health Considerations

Foot health demands consistent attention in Rambouillets as in all sheep breeds, with their heavier body weight creating additional stress on feet and legs compared to lighter breeds. Regular hoof trimming prevents overgrowth that causes gait abnormalities and creates conditions favorable to foot rot and foot scald. The wet conditions that promote these diseases require management through good drainage in housing areas, footbaths when problems appear in the flock, and in some cases culling sheep with chronic foot problems that do not respond to treatment. Lameness during breeding season reduces ram effectiveness, while lame ewes during late pregnancy face increased risk of metabolic problems from reduced mobility to feeders.

Parasite management represents one of the most significant health challenges for any sheep operation, and Rambouillets face the same internal parasite pressures as other breeds. The barber pole worm causes particular damage in humid climates, while various other gastrointestinal parasites affect sheep across all environments. Develop a deworming protocol based on fecal egg count monitoring rather than routine calendar-based treatment, targeting sheep with significant parasite loads while avoiding unnecessary treatments that accelerate resistance development. Pasture management through rotation helps break parasite life cycles and reduces the challenge your sheep face from contaminated grazing areas.

Wool-related health issues affect Rambouillets specifically because of their dense, fine fleeces. Wool blindness occurs when fleece grows over the eyes, obstructing vision and causing stress and poor performance - keeping the face clipped or selecting for open-faced genetics addresses this problem. Flystrike risk increases with dense fleeces in warm, humid conditions, particularly around the breech area where urine and fecal soiling creates attractive conditions for blowflies. Watch for early signs of strike including restless sheep, excessive tail movement, and discolored or wet wool around the tail area. Treatment requires shearing the affected area, removing maggots, and applying appropriate insecticide treatments to prevent reinfestation.

Pregnancy toxemia risk in Rambouillets relates to their metabolic efficiency and tendency to deposit internal fat that can restrict rumen capacity during late gestation. Manage body condition carefully, avoiding both excessive fat deposition during the maintenance period and inadequate nutrition during the critical final weeks of pregnancy. Ewes carrying multiple lambs require particular attention, with energy supplementation increasing gradually during the final six weeks to meet the escalating demands of rapidly growing fetuses. Monitor late-pregnant ewes closely for early signs of ketosis including depression, separation from the flock, and the characteristic sweet breath odor of ketone accumulation.

Section 5 Breed Considerations

Selecting Rambouillet breeding stock requires balancing wool characteristics, body conformation, and the structural soundness that determines productive longevity. Evaluate fleece quality including fiber diameter, staple length, crimp definition, and freedom from undesirable traits like kemp or excessive grease. Body frame should be large but not coarse, with adequate muscling for meat production while maintaining the feminine appearance of good breeding ewes or the masculine characteristics of an effective ram. Structural soundness in feet, legs, and mouth ensures animals can graze effectively and remain productive for multiple years rather than breaking down early from poor conformation.

Purebred versus commercial Rambouillet operations have different selection priorities that affect which animals you should purchase and how you evaluate your flock. Purebred breeders maintaining registered flocks select toward breed standards and must consider the marketability of breeding stock to other purebred producers. Commercial operations value production traits more heavily than breed purity, often using Rambouillet ewes as a maternal base crossed with terminal sire breeds that improve carcass characteristics in market lambs. Understanding your market helps determine whether purebred genetics or commercial utility should drive your selection decisions.

Rambouillet crosses with other breeds create useful combinations that leverage the breed's strengths while adding characteristics from other genetic sources. Crossing Rambouillet ewes with meat breed rams produces market lambs with better muscling and faster growth than purebred Rambouillets while retaining the maternal instincts and hardiness of Rambouillet mothers. Crossing with other fine-wool breeds can improve specific wool characteristics or introduce genetic diversity. First-cross ewes from Rambouillet dams often make excellent commercial ewes, combining hybrid vigor with the proven maternal traits that Rambouillets provide.

Section 6 Common Mistakes To Avoid

The most costly mistake new Rambouillet owners make is treating these wool sheep like meat breeds with casual attention to fleece management and handling that damages the wool crop. Every time a Rambouillet catches against rough surfaces, walks through weedy vegetation, or lies on poor quality bedding, potential fleece value disappears into contamination that buyers discount heavily or reject entirely. Maintain awareness that you are producing two products from these sheep - meat and wool - and the wool requires ongoing protection throughout the year, not just attention during the brief shearing period. Facilities, pastures, and handling practices should all account for wool protection as a management priority.

Shearing delays that leave Rambouillets in heavy fleece through hot weather create serious welfare and performance problems that first-time owners may not anticipate. The dense, fine wool that makes Rambouillets valuable insulates extremely well - too well when summer heat arrives and sheep cannot dissipate body heat through fleece that nature designed for cold weather survival. Heat-stressed sheep stop eating, lose condition, and may die from hyperthermia if shearing comes too late relative to rising temperatures. Shear before hot weather arrives in your region, adjusting timing based on your local climate rather than following schedules designed for different environments.

Neglecting the reproductive management aspects that affect Rambouillet fertility and lamb production undermines the entire operation regardless of how well you manage other aspects. These sheep evolved as rangeland animals where survival often mattered more than maximum reproductive rate, and some Rambouillet bloodlines show later maturity and lower prolificacy than breeds selected primarily for lamb production. Plan breeding programs that account for realistic expectations, provide the nutrition that supports reproduction, and select replacement animals from ewes that consistently raise lambs rather than those that look best but fail to produce.

Failing to market wool effectively wastes much of the value these sheep produce, yet many small flock owners treat shearing as simply a welfare necessity rather than a harvest of valuable fiber. Rambouillet wool commands premium prices compared to most other breeds, but only if you produce clean, well-prepared fleeces and find buyers willing to pay for quality. Learn proper fleece preparation including skirting to remove inferior wool, keeping fleeces clean during handling and storage, and either finding direct markets to handspinners and small mills or working with buyers who appreciate and pay for premium fine wool.

Ignoring the breed's specific health vulnerabilities because Rambouillets seem generally hardy leads to preventable problems that affect individual animals and flock productivity. Yes, these sheep survive conditions that would stress less robust breeds, but they remain susceptible to the same diseases and parasites that affect all sheep. Their dense fleeces require attention to wool-related issues including flystrike, wool blindness, and heat stress. Their metabolic efficiency means they gain fat easily and face pregnancy toxemia risk when overfed then undernourished. Their heavy body weights stress feet and legs that need consistent care. Managing for the breed's actual needs rather than an idealized version of rangeland hardiness produces healthier, more productive sheep.
